A tricky contest to assess and it may prove wise to heed the claim in favour of last-time-out runner-up B FIFTY TWO. That was a pleasing return to form and he was only just caught late on. The 7lb claim now would make him hard to hold on similar form and the headgear is also returning to aid his cause now. Ballesteros is not the most consistent but could have a say while former C&D winner One Boy comes here in excellent heart and has to be respected despite his latest ratings hike. Noah Amor and Economic Crisis complete the shortlist in a wide open race.
